Boulder: Fight Brewing with State

Boulder County received a letter from Colorado’s Attorney General Cynthia Coffman dated January 26 in which the County was asked to end its gas and oil ban by February 10 or risk legal action. Larimer County: County Convenes Workforce Housing Task Force

On August 31 Larimer County held the first meeting of its workforce housing task force. Donnelly Retains Seat

In one of the most unexpected outcomes in this election, incumbent Tom Donnelly appears to have narrowly defeated challenger Karen Stockley and will serve a second term as the County Commissioner from District 2, which includes Loveland and the southern portion of Larimer County.
